2025/04/07

Explanation of Operational Impact of U.S. Reciprocal Tariffs

產品圖片

After reviewing U.S. import tariff documents, the Company's product “sodium tungstate” is not included among the products subject to additional tariffs, and in 2024 the quantity of the Company's “sodium tungstate” exported to the United States accounted for only approximately 10% of its total export volume. In addition, China's Ministry of Commerce implemented export controls on five major items, including tungsten, starting February 4 of this year, and the United States had already imposed an additional 25% import tariff on tungsten products imported from China into the United States. Therefore, after the United States implemented reciprocal tariffs this time, the Company's sodium tungstate sales remain quite competitive.

In addition, the subsidiary's “cobalt metal-related products” are not included among the products subject to additional tariffs and have not yet been exported to the United States; therefore, the United States' implementation of reciprocal tariffs this time also has no impact on the subsidiary's financial position or operations.
